Publishers Weekly Review

Modern-day piracy, decomposing human remains and a swanky Miami yacht club set the mood for another top-notch thriller from romance icon Graham (Killing Kelly). During a weekend camp-out on isolated Calliope Key, "compellingly attractive" Beth Anderson and her 14-year-old niece, Amber, stumble on a half-buried human skull that disappears by the time she returns with help. Ben, Beth's brother and Amber's father, suspects the object was merely a conch shell, but it's a safe bet that conch shells don't grow hair. More likely, someone on the island took the skull for reasons of his or her own-like hunky Keith Henson, the enigmatic diver who'd been lurking about at the time of the grisly discovery. Back home in Miami, Beth is stalked and harassed by ominous threats, forcing her to solicit the aid of a couple of cop pals, who set a trap for the culprit at the yacht club's Summer Sizzler festival. Even though the tale falls short as a real knuckle-biter, bestseller Graham doesn't disappoint with the steamy romance between Keith and Beth or the glamorous yacht-club doings. Boat lovers are sure to enjoy the fine attention to detail regarding luxury pleasure craft. (Mar.) (c) Copyright PWxyz, LLC. All rights reserved

Booklist Review

On a camping trip to Calliope Key, Beth Anderson finds a skull in the woods. She hides it, planning to return for it later. Keith Henson is a scuba-diving adventurer visiting the island with two friends in a beautifully appointed yacht. That evening the various campers on the island come together for an informal cookout, and Beth suspects that each is there for nefarious purposes. Deducing that the skull may be that of one of a popular retired couple not seen for several months, Beth returns for it, but it seems to have disappeared. Soon all the players from the island reassemble at the yacht club, while every time Beth turns around, the strikingly attractive Keith Henson is there. Is he really trying to protect her, as he claims, or is he actually a modern-day pirate, as she fears? With more than a hundred books to her credit, Graham always writes a satisfyingly entertaining read. --Diana Tixier Herald Copyright 2006 Booklist
